Today I decided to look at all my blogs and see when I posted last. For some it was just one month ago, but then I came here and saw that I had abandoned this blog for almost 9 weeks, which is like forever on the web.
So I decided to write about not writing.
Suddenly this Spring I became so tired. I was dealing with some emotional stuff in the family, aging parents, weather changes, schedule changes as I continue to get busier, and health stuff including hormonal fluctuations and dental work. Add that to my big move to NYC this year and you have a whole lot of stress (mostly good, yes, but still stress).
I used to write through my stress. Writing helped me process. But this time writing was that straw that I felt would break my back. I just couldn’t do it. I did get a few interviews up on The Morton Report, but very little on my sites, and no emails.
Now I feel some energy to write and share. I am also practicing more reiki, for myself and clients, which really does help as always.
How do you deal with times of low energy and high stress?
